Activities in nature carry certain intrinsic risks. For this reason, it is necessary to highlight some recommendations for the practice of hiking, which allow improving the safety of people. You can encourage this behavior by remembering these simple rules, which are specified in the following:
- Prepare in advance the excursion to be made:
Check the weather forecast and check that the technical characteristics of the route are appropriate for you.
- Clothing and footwear must be suitable for hiking.
- Carry enough food and water, some warm clothes, sunscreen, a hat and a charged mobile phone in your backpack. Canes can also be useful.
- Always walk in company and only on the marked path.
- Always inform family or friends of the route you are going to take.
Remember: traveling through the natural environment carries risks. You walk under your responsibility. Be cautious. If you need it, call 911.
